...But I guess we will have to see, as the Yankees and Reds take the field today, both teams with talented rotations and lineups; one with many more expectations and even more to lose if their season isn't a successful one. The anticipation has built to an all-time high throughout the Yankees' extremely eventful and productive off-season. With CC Sabathia and AJ Burnett beefing up [let's hope this time that doesn't mean literally] the Bombers' already-stellar rotation [joining Wang, Pettite and Chamberlain], this could finally be the year they've been looking for since their last title in 2000. And I don't even need to get started on the line-up [with or without ARod, it's unreal]. This season is going to be one for the books. I guess when you're talking about the Yanks, what year isn't?

The hype around the Reds this year should be great for the city, even though year in and year out Cincy crawls with die-hards despite god-awful records. Their young, carefree players won't be playing under much pressure, and should provide for great entertainment at Great American Ballpark. It would be nice if they get to make a postseason appearance. I mean, it's been about 15 years anyway.
